3 MORE KINDER CHOCO PRODUCTS RECALLED, POSSIBLE PRESENCE OF SALMONELLA

0

Just days ago the Singapore Food Agency (SFA) published in the media on one of Kinder Surprise Chocolates but the recall list has expanded to three more products including the famous egg shape Kinder Surprise.

Please take note the following products and date batches.

Here is what SFA said on Facebook:

Further to the media release on 6 April 2022, SFA has extended a recall of three Kinder products – Kinder Mini Eggs (75g), Kinder Egg Hunt Kit (150g) and Kinder Surprise Maxi (100g) from Belgium – due to the possible presence Salmonella.The recall for the affected products is ongoing. Consumers who have consumed the implicated products and have concerns about their health should seek medical advice. Consumers may contact the importers Redmart Ltd and Le Petit Depot Pte. Ltd for enquiries.”

CAR CRASHES THROUGH MOTORCYCLE LANE @ TUAS CHECKPOINT TO EVADE ARREST

0

According to a media release by the Immigrations and Checkpoints Authority (ICA), two men and a woman are currently being detained for certain offences and also for not stopping for arrival immigration clearance when they reached Tuas Checkpoint.

This happened on 8 April 2022 at 2.14am when the Malaysian registered vehicle which was driven by a Singaporean male avoided clearance at Malaysia’s immigration when departing, which led to Malaysia’s Traffic Police giving chase.

An Auxiliary Police Officer (APO) who was on duty at Tuas Checkpoint spotted this and activated the alarm which locked down Tuas Checkpoint.

Tried to avoid the lockdown at the Checkpoint

The driver then tried to avoid the lockdown by squeezing through the motorcycle lanes but failed because the lanes were too narrow for his vehicle.

While attempting, the vehicle crashed into the counters and also caused an abrasion to an officer’s ankle.

Subsequently, the driver was caught by the ICA officers.

Passengers tried to flee on foot

The two passengers who were inside the vehicle also tried to flee on foot but was caught by APO officers in the end.

Based on their declaration, the two passengers were identified as a male Chinese national and a female Vietnamese national.

Both allegedly did not have any valid travel documents on them.

Driver wanted by Central Narcotics Bureau

The Driver was also discovered to be wanted by the Central Narcotics Bureau (CNB) after initial investigations were conducted.

He was in possession of a Singapore Passport which is tampered.

A urine test was also conducted on the driver and he was found to be positive for drug consumption.

Immigration & Passport Act

The ICA would like to reiterate that it takes a serious view on attempts to enter Singapore illegally and also on possession of tampered Singapore travel documents.

Under the Immigration Act, those attempting to enter Singapore illegally are liable to be punished with imprisonment of up to six months and minimum of three strokes of the cane.

Under the Passport Act, those found possessing false Singapore travel documents are liable to a fine of up to $10,000 and imprisonment of up to 10 years or both.

Those who damage government properties are liable to a fine of $2,000 or imprisonment of up to three years and caning.

SIA FLIGHTS TO & FROM SHANGHAI CANCELLED ON 11 APR 2022

0

Singapore’s National Carrier, Singapore Airlines (SQ) has issued an advisory on their Facebook page with regards to the cancellation of flight SQ830 (Singapore to Shanghai) and SQ833 (Shanghai to Singapore) on 11 April 2022.

SQ cited operational reasons as well as the lockdown measures in Shanghai as reasons for the cancellation of the flights.

They have also apologised to affected customers and are reaching out to them to offer their assistance to minimise the inconvenience brought to all affected customers due to the cancellation of these flights.

Here is the advisory posted by Singapore Airlines

“Singapore Airlines flights SQ830 (Singapore to Shanghai) and SQ833 (Shanghai to Singapore) departing on 11 April 2022 will be cancelled due to operational constraints as a result of the regulatory lockdown measures in Shanghai.

SIA would like to extend our sincere apologies to the affected customers. We are reaching out to them to offer all necessary assistance, and to minimise the inconvenience caused by this disruption.”

Shanghai’s lockdown

The Chinese city announced on 27 March that it will be going through a lockdown in two stages to conduct a Covid-19 testing after a new daily record of infections was recorded in the city.

Authorities ordered residents to remain at home so that testing in the city’s eastern and western district can be conducted on 28 March to 1 April as well as 1 Apr to 5 Apr.

However, another round of testing has just begun as there were more than 20,000 cases reported in China on Wednesday.

CRAFT BEER PRODUCED USING NEWATER TO GO ON SALE TO PUBLIC

0

In a joint press release by NEWater as well as Brewerkz, it was announced that a new craft beer known as NEWBrew will be released for sale to the public from 12 April 2022 to end July.

NEWBrew is described as smooth with a bit of bitterness and not too sweet and comprises 95 percent of NEWater, which is Singapore’s own water made from a desalination plant.

Ingredients include:

  • Premium German barley malts
  • Aromatic citra
  • Calypso hops
  • Kveik

The 2022 version of NEWBrew is a tropical blonde ale, available in packs of three and will cost $4.50 a can, and it can be purchased from NTUC FairPrice, Cold Storage, online platforms and Brewerkz’s restaurant and e-store.

The three cans will also feature different designs such as Marina Barrage, MacRitchie Reservoir and Singapore River which are three of Singapore’s water landmarks.

To be served at Singapore’s International Water Week 2022

NEWBrew will also be served at Singapore’s International Water Week (SIWW) 2022 for the second time, with the first occasion being in 2018.

SIWW’s managing director, Mr Ryan Yuen was quoted saying:

“NEWBrew is possibly Singapore’s greenest beer and the perfect accompaniment to this year’s SIWW, with its key themes of climate resilience, resource circularity and water sustainability”

“We are delighted to partner Brewerkz to bring NEWBrew back again, as it is also part of PUB’s efforts to educate Singaporeans on the importance of water recycling and reuse as a strategy to achieve water sustainability. It also reinforces the message that NEWater is perfectly wholesome and safe for drinking, and can be used to make a great tasting beer.”
